Residency with Emphasis in Primary Care
Program Description
The Pharmacy Residency Program with an emphasis in a Community Oriented Primary Care Practice is co-sponsored by the University of Connecticut School of Pharmacy & Hartford Hospital. This is a one-year program to develop general skills in institutional pharmacy practice (6 months) with a special focus in primary care pharmacotherapy (6 months) while providing opportunities for didactic and clinical teaching and research. 

Rotational Experiences
The following core rotations will be required:

  •        Central and Decentralized Training
  •        Critical Care
  •        Drug information
  •        Internal Medicine
  •        Pain Management
  •        Practice Management
  •        Primary Care
  •        Research
  •        Service
Elective Experiences can be selected from the following categories depending upon availability:
  •       Academic Rotation
  •       Ambulatory Psychiatry
  •       Anticoagulation 
  •       Cardiology
  •       Family Medicine
  •       Outpatient HIV/AIDS Clinic
                
Primary Care Focus
The primary training site will be at the Adult Primary Care Center of Hartford Hospital. The resident will be expected to develop a strong knowledge base in common ambulatory care disease conditions that include but are not limited to the following: hypertension, diabetes mellitus, hyperlipidemia, asthma, smoking cessation, CAD, congestive heart failure, infectious disease, hormone replacement therapy, rheumatoid and osteoarthritis.
 
The resident will participate in daily patient-care activities that may include patient counseling, interview, and history taking, and limited physical assessment skills. The resident will assess current drug therapy, and design an individualized therapeutic plan with appropriate follow-up to evaluate outcomes. The resident will be expected to provide extensive patient education in various disease states and their management in pharmacist-managed specialty clinics. The resident will be expected to complete a major research project to be presented at an annual resident conference.
